Re-edition and remastering on LP of one of the rare records by this musician known for his talents as an arranger (Gainsbourg, Polnareff…) or as composer of the music for the film “Emmanuelle”. In 1979, Michel Colombier offered the public an album fusing jazz, pop, classical music and funk. Accompanied by the greatest musicians (Jaco Pastorius, Herbie Hancock, Steve Gadd, Larry Carlton, Michael Brecker, etc.), this “sound director” brought out the best in each sideman.
